Post by: jsm on November 30, 2010, 08:04:33 pm
top bit of kitt - i had one last year after all that snow - easy fit two inch holes in floor wire up stat and hook up gas , 20 mins top - they sound great bit like a deep v8 , ive got a silencer coming for mine this year .

set stat to temp wanted and it fires up , it hooks up to a 12 volt batt also , i used a spare one just in case it run the main one down . i had mine running 24/7 friday to monday morn last year no problems

you will need to insulate the van tho really or you will be wasting heat - ive just spent 2 days insulating my new one - found a cracking insulatation , 10mm foam carpet underlay , just spray tacked glue to sides and roof with ply over the top .
